I guess the altitude is too low at 1000 m. You would need to go at very least >1500 m altitude. But hey. You know what's going to be ripe in September . When you're in Thun you might want to see "Kandersteg" A very nice town (but lots of Tourists there). I'm from another place in Switzerland so i don't know too much about Canton Bern or Luzern. What you might need to know is that if you travel like 100 km (60 miles) the language already changes a lot. It can be like going from GB to California. A lot of different kinds of German (Swiss is actually a kind of German same for Austria).
